Home
Search for Apartment Reviews
FAQ
Home
Search
FAQ
Cambridge Square North
Indianapolis, IN
Location
7110 Township Line Road
Indianapolis
,
IN
46260
(317) 299-7085
Overall Rating
★★★★★
★★★★★
Met My Needs
Overall value
Service Quality
0%
0
out of
0
renters
recommend this apartment.
Recently Viewed
★★★★★
★★★★★
Hampstead Oaks
200 Hampstead Ave
Savannah, GA 31405
★★★★★
★★★★★
North Pointe
1688 Route 9
Clifton Park, NY 12065
★★★★★
★★★★★
Alexan Auburn Lakes
6000 Rayford Road
Spring, TX 77389
★★★★★
★★★★★
Twin Oaks
2754 E. Pauldine Rod
Fort Wayne, IN 46816
★★★★★
★★★★★
Revitalize SouthSide
439 Pine Street
Providence, RI 02907
Reviews
No reviews found.